小二乘法是一種常用的數(shù)據(jù)擬合方法,它主要用于求解一組數(shù)據(jù)點的擬合直線或曲線。在實際應用中,經(jīng)常需要對一些實驗數(shù)據(jù)進行分析和處理,通過小二乘法可以得到數(shù)據(jù)之間的關系,從而為后續(xù)的研究提供依據(jù)。
,主要需要以下幾個步驟
1.讀取數(shù)據(jù)首先需要從文件或者其他數(shù)據(jù)源中讀取需要進行擬合的數(shù)據(jù),將其存儲在數(shù)組中。
2.計算平均值通過遍歷數(shù)組,計算出數(shù)據(jù)的平均值,作為后續(xù)計算的基礎。
3.計算方差通過遍歷數(shù)組,計算出每個數(shù)據(jù)點與平均值之間的差值的平方,然后將所有差值的平方相加,除以數(shù)據(jù)點的個數(shù),得到方差。
4.計算協(xié)方差通過遍歷數(shù)組,計算出每個數(shù)據(jù)點與另一個數(shù)據(jù)點之間的差值的乘積,然后將所有乘積相加,除以數(shù)據(jù)點的個數(shù),得到協(xié)方差。
5.計算斜率和截距通過計算得到的方差和協(xié)方差,可以求解出擬合直線的斜率和截距。
6.輸出結果將計算得到的斜率和截距輸出到屏幕或者其他文件中,以供后續(xù)的使用。
以上就是的主要步驟,通過這些步驟可以得到一組數(shù)據(jù)的擬合直線或曲線,為數(shù)據(jù)分析和處理提供了便利。